    What You Will Do:


    As a compassionate member of the care team will welcome patients and their families when they arrive, putting them at ease and setting the tone for the rest of the visit.

    During the patient interaction, accurately gathers complete demographic information to ensure electronic health record integrity consistent with high reliability organization principles.

    To ensure a seamless visit, identifies correct network coverage and obtains and/or validates healthcare benefits and/or pre-certification for applicable tests and/or procedures.

    These efforts maximize reimbursement for services rendered.

    Educates patients and/or families about applicable legal, ethical, and compliance documents; ensures regulatory consents are signed by the appropriate parties.

    Engages with patients in understanding their financial obligations based on the financial policy and accurately prepares estimates to collect co-payments, self-pay deposits, and patient balances.

    Ensures all payor and government required elements are completed correctly, particularly the MSPQ, Important Message from Medicare (IMM) and medical necessity checking (ABN and Letter of Non-Coverage).As a highly reliable organization stays up to date and complies with all applicable regulations with the operating systems, entity and system policies and procedures.

    Maintains customer service and/or productivity guidelines set forth by applicable leadership.
    Engaged and willing partner who mentors peers, exhibits flexibility, and adapts easily to change.
    Participates in staff meetings, process improvement, special projects and completes other duties as assigned.
    Maintains daily Epic work queue and personal Employee Scorecard Dashboard.

    Team member is responsible for maintaining awareness and accuracy of THR contracted insurance plans; as well the ability to communicate with patients/and families alerting patients of Out of Network and advise of potential financial implications, such as non-coverage.

    Texas Health Denton Highlights:


    Texas Health Denton is a 255-bed, full-service hospital providing convenient care to people across North Texas and Southern Oklahoma since 1987.

    With more than 1,100 employees and 450 physicians on our medical staff were one of Denton Countys largest employers.

    We specialize in Cancer Care, Neck & Back Program, Critical Care, Neonatology, CT Cardiac Imaging, Neurology, Electrophysiology, Orthopedics & Sports Medicine, Emergency Care, Robotic Surgery, Endovascular Surgery, Stroke Care, General Surgery, Weight Loss Surgery, Heart & Vascular Services, Women & Infants Care, Interventional Radiology and Wound Care & Hyperbaric Treatment.

    Texas Health Denton is a Joint Commission-accredited Primary (Level II) Stroke Center and Chest Pain Center, a Metabolic & Bariatric Surgery Center of Excellence and a Magnet designated hospital.

    Our four-story specialty center for women and infants features 12 labor and delivery beds, 2 C-section suites along with 6 antepartum and 24 postpartum beds.

    Texas Health Denton is the citys only provider of obstetrical and neonatal intensive care services and is the largest provider of obstetrical services in Denton County.

    The ground floor houses a breast imaging center, outpatient physical therapy, cardiac rehabilitation and an internal medicine residency program.
